Wheels Manufacturing T47 Outboard Bottom Bracket with Angular Contact Bearings for 30mm Spindles Fits B.B. shells 68mm to 100mm. T47 Outboard threaded bottom brackets are made from machined aluminum and thread together directly into T47 frames. Cups have outboard bearings and are typically used in BB shells with widths from 68mm to 100mm.
  • Enduro Angular Contact bearings - easily serviced or replaced
  • Similar to standard BSA threaded cups; the drive side cup is left-hand thread and the non-drive side cup is right-hand thread
